The Music Stand was founded by pianist & composer Arlington Jones & his wife Hope in 2013. Having overcome personal and professional obstacles, Arlington and Hope have a heart to encourage musicians and their families to rise above the challenges of life and reach their full potential. Since the beginning of their marriage, they have mentored individuals and couples in the music industry. They are known for producing inspiring music, exciting concerts, and creative music education programs. 

Mission

The Music Stand enriches and uplifts lives through innovative artistic expression, interactive education & artist support.

Just a few years ago, most musicians couldn't find regular work and many full-time positions were eliminated. And now, musicians, like many people in the world, are still catching up from that deficit. According to the Bureau of Labor Statistics, the projected employment growth of musicians and singers is only 2%. For these reasons, The Music Stand seeks to provide artist work opportunities and increase wages. We value the gifts and talents of artists. Music and the arts are important industries and bring great benefits to our wellness and life enrichment. We understand music consumption and markets bring in billions of dollars, but artists rarely receive fair, equitable wages for the work they do and art they create. The Music Stand wants to help change that narrative.

Throughout the past year, we have been continuing to support artist through emergency funding and work partnerships, developing a wellness platform for music industry professionals, strengthening partnerships & collaborations, and hosting educational film screenings. We also launched a Young Artists program that honors their achievements, supports their endeavors, and offers platforms to showcase their gifts. Last summer, we hosted our first arts festival in Arlington, TX featuring a four-day cultural celebration of music, dance & arts, and we look forward to the next time!
